SHLD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

182 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sears Holding Corporation (SHLD)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$3.19B — up 23% from $2.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 35 funds opened new SHLD positions and 30 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 55 added to existing stakes and 53 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Omega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$31.6M. The largest seller was Fine Capital Partners, cutting an estimated $39.5M.
